watso found an old electric yoghurt maker in the back of a cupboard somewhere - watso cannot recall it ever being used - maybe the ex wife bought it - cannot recall.
anyway the phillips electric yoghurt maker turned out to be a little gem, and watso has worked out the perfect way to make yoghurt with almost zilch cleaning.
the first batch of yoghurt in the electric yoghurt maker was made by using half a sachet of yoghurt in 1 litre of uht milk - when that was made, then pour that lot into a second container - then immediately use the container that fits into the yoghurt maker again - no cleaning - just add uht milk to the leftover yoghurt in the container - then add a teaspoon or two of extra from the satchet - give it a shake - and put in the maker again.
could not be easier
